This is today's edition of The Download, our weekday newsletter that provides a daily dose of what's going on in the world of ...
The New Times is Rwanda’s largest private media organization. The company was established in 1995, a year after the Genocide Against the Tutsi had come to an end. Rwanda was defined by the horrific 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results